By: Lagatah Toyos

TAWAU: Two men were injured in an accident involving two vehicles—a Proton Saga and a motorcycle —on Jalan Kuhara early Sunday morning.

Tawau Fire and Rescue Station (BBP) Chief, Jemishin Ujin, said the 37-year-old car driver and 33-year-old motorcyclist refused to be taken to the hospital.

He said both victims, who sustained minor injuries, received initial treatment from the Emergency Medical Rescue Services (EMRS) team and Ministry of Health medical officers.

According to him, the fire department received an emergency call regarding the accident at 3.26am via MERS999 and arrived at the scene in two minutes.

“A team of eight personnel along with two fire engines was immediately dispatched to the location to carry out rescue operations,” he said in a media statement on Sunday.

The operation ended at 3.40 am after ensuring there were no further hazards at the scene.
